PyLaTeX is a Python library for creating and compiling LaTeX files or snippets. The goal of this library is being an easy, but extensible interface between Python and LaTeX.

Installation

Simply install using pip:

pip install pylatex

And then install a relevant LaTeX processor and other dependencies. Examples:

Ubuntu

sudo apt-get install texlive-pictures texlive-science texlive-latex-extra latexmk
